Gradient descent — the algorithm that trains every AI model — works by following the steepest downward slope on an error surface. Slope isn't just geometry. It's the most important algorithm in machine learning.
Every layer of a neural network is a mathematical function: it takes inputs, applies a transformation, and produces outputs. Understanding functions means understanding what a neural network is actually doing, layer by layer.
Machine learning finds mathematical relationships in scatter plot data — the same relationships your child learns to spot in Grade 8. Linear regression, correlation, and the line of best fit are the foundations of supervised learning.
